1. A surveillance system for detecting the presence of unallowed objects in a restricted space, comprising:

  • a radar having a data output and further comprising an electromagnetic wave transmitter having at least two output antennas commutated to the transmitter output by means of transmitter switch,an electromagnetic wave receiver having an output and at least two input antennas commutated to the receiver input by means of receiver switch,a control unit operating said transmitter and receiver switches to select a pair of one input antenna and one output antenna at any given time,a video camera adapted to take successive image frames of the restricted space,a signal processor having a radar data input, a camera data input and an output, anda storing device connected to the signal processor, wherein stored in the storing device are;

    reference data relating to the restricted area and obtained in the absence of any object in the restricted area, sets of parameters of allowed objects, and radar calibration data acquired during calibration process in which for each pair of input and output antennas a predefined test object is located in each radar resolution cell,the signal processor being adapted to detecting the presence of object images in image frames by their contours using the reference data, calculating parameters of each object image and then calculating radar cross-section corresponding to each detected object image using the radar calibration data from the storing device, andcomparing calculated parameters of each object image detected in the restricted area image frame against each set of parameters of allowed objects and generating an alarm signal according to this comparison result.
